Are You Providing Nutrition Services Under the NYS 1115 Medicaid Waiver? 
Join a Technical Assistance Group!

 

Part of the mission of the NYS Food as Medicine Coalition is to enhance communication and collaboration between stakeholders. We have heard from FAM stakeholders across the state that there is a need to have space to share best practices, issues, and drive discussion to build even more best practices. In the spirit of our mission and to serve you, our members and stakeholders, we are offering monthly technical assistance groups based on type of service provided. Please register for the group that best matches your service.

 

​

  • Medically Tailored/Clinically Appropriate Food Prescriptions - 1st Tuesdays, 3:00pm EST - Register

 

  • Medically Tailored/Clinically Appropriate Meals - 2nd Tuesdays, 3:00pm EST - Register

 

  • Pantry Stocking - 4th Tuesdays, 3:00pm EST - Register
